About

The Sacred Union (2018) is a narrative about the artist, archaeologist, writer
and theosophist Nicholas Roerich. The video focuses on a period of Roerich’s
life in which he pursued a utopian project he referred to as the Sacred Union of
the East. His aim was to recruit Buddhist masses to join his spiritual
commonwealth under Bolshevik Russia. As the protagonist travels through
various landscapes of Mongolia, his external appearance is slowing transforming
to illustrate the true intent of his mission. Initially, his outer appearance seems to
indicate that he is pursuing a spiritual journey aligned with Tibetan Buddhist
pursuits. As the journey unfolds, we see that his real allegiance is to Bolshevik
Russia. The Sacred Union highlights a figure who simultaneously strives to unite
cultures including America, Buddhist Asia, Bolshevik Russia and India while also
strengthening their divisions as a result of his disingenuous rhetoric.
